#97a6d9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#97a6d9 is composed of 59.2% red, 65.1%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.4% cyan, 23.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 226.4 degrees, a saturation of 46.5% and a lightness of 72.2%. #97a6d9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2f4db3.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#97a6d9 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#97a6d9 has RGB values of R:151, G:166, B:217 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0.24,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 9938649.

Shades and Tints of #97a6d9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04060b is the darkest color, while #fcf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#97a6d9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b8b8b8 is the less saturated color, while #7694fa is the most saturated one.
